2008-03-05pasemi_mac: jumbo frame supportOlof Johansson1-1/+14
First cut at jumbo frame support. To support large MTU, one or several separate channels must be allocated to calculate the TCP/UDP checksum separately, since the mac lacks enough buffers to hold a whole packet while it's being calculated. Furthermore, it seems that a single function channel is not quite enough to feed one of the 10Gig links, so allocate two channels for XAUI interfaces. 2008-01-28pasemi_mac: Fix TX cleaningOlof Johansson1-0/+1
pasemi_mac: Fix TX cleaning This is a bit awkward. We don't have a timer-delayed interrupt on TX complete, but we have a count threshold. So set that reasonably high (32 packets), and schedule the NAPI poll when it goes off. Also bump a regular timer that will take care of rotting packets for the last 1..31 ones in case we don't trigger a TX interrupt (and there's no RX activity that would otherwise trigger the poll). The longer-term fix is to separate TX from RX NAPI and do two separate poll loops. Signed-off-by: Olof Johansson <olof@lixom.net> Signed-off-by: Jeff Garzik <jeff@garzik.org>

2007-10-10[NET]: Make NAPI polling independent of struct net_device objects.Stephen Hemminger1-0/+1
Several devices have multiple independant RX queues per net device, and some have a single interrupt doorbell for several queues. In either case, it's easier to support layouts like that if the structure representing the poll is independant from the net device itself. The signature of the ->poll() call back goes from: int foo_poll(struct net_device *dev, int *budget) to int foo_poll(struct napi_struct *napi, int budget) The caller is returned the number of RX packets processed (or the number of "NAPI credits" consumed if you want to get abstract). The callee no longer messes around bumping dev->quota, *budget, etc. because that is all handled in the caller upon return. The napi_struct is to be embedded in the device driver private data structures. Furthermore, it is the driver's responsibility to disable all NAPI instances in it's ->stop() device close handler. Since the napi_struct is privatized into the driver's private data structures, only the driver knows how to get at all of the napi_struct instances it may have per-device.
